I'm 19 yo started finasteride and min 7 months ago. Initially I got good improvement and my itchiness, scalp pain and back acne went away. After month 2 my hair started to fall out again with 2x more itchy than pre finasteride. Scalp became more oily and I feel some pain on scalp while brushing and touching my hair , back acne also came back. My hair on top is completely thined out and feels so unhealthy. Lost a significant amount of ground in last 5 months. Went from straight hairline to M shaped narrow hairline. I feel like i got reflex hyperandrogenicity. Don't know what to do. NEED help!
